A leading Illinois police organization is making some endorsements for the upcoming June primary.

 

The Illinois Fraternal Order of Police State Lodge is backing Republican Dan Brady for secretary of state. Brady is facing former Sangamon County State’s Attorney and U.S. Attorney John Milhiser in the GOP primary. In a statement, the FOP says it chose Brady because of what it calls his “unwavering lifetime support for law enforcement.” Meanwhile, the state FOP has also endorsed Thomas DeVore over Steve Kim in the Republican primary for attorney general. DeVore announced the endorsement last week on social media.

 

The FOP confirms that it is backing DeVore, but has not put out a statement about the endorsement.
